PER CURIAM:

Donald Parker appeals the district court’s order dismissing his

42 U.S.C. § 1983

complaint under 28 U.S.C. § 1915A(b). We have reviewed the record and find no

reversible error. Accordingly, we affirm the district court’s order. Parker v. Portsmouth

City Police Dep’t, No. 3:23-cv-00600-JAG-MRC (E.D. Va. May 29, 2024). We dispense

with oral argument because the facts and legal contentions are adequately presented in the

materials before this court and argument would not aid the decisional process.

AFFIRMED
